From: Hans Dedecker Date: Thu, 16 Feb 2017 11:20:08 +0000 (+0100) Subject: router: support ra_mininterval and ra_lifetime uci parameters (FS#397) X-Git-Url: http://git.archive.openwrt.org/?p=project%2Fodhcpd.git;a=commitdiff_plain;h=942fb33d3017e8769a7354ee008daf0f31a40fe2;hp=942fb33d3017e8769a7354ee008daf0f31a40fe2 router: support ra_mininterval and ra_lifetime uci parameters (FS#397) Add support for uci parameters ra_mininterval and ra_lifetime as described in RFC4861 paragraph 6.2.1. Variable ra_mininterval allows to configure the minimum interval time between unsolicited router advertisement messages; default value is 200 seconds. The minimum allowed value is 4 seconds while the maximum value is limited to 0.75 of the maximum interval time. The calculation of the maximum interval time between unsolicited router advertisement messages has been reworked. The default value is 600 seconds as specified in RFC4861; if the maximum interval time exceeds 0.33 * the minimal valid lifetime of all IPv6 prefixes it will be limited to 0.33 * the minimal valid lifetime of all IPv6 prefixes Variable ra_lifetime allows to configure the Router Lifetime field in the router advertisement messages; the value is either 0 or a value between the maximum interval time and 9000 seconds. If the router lifetime is smaller than the RA maximum interval it will be set equal to the RA maximum interval time. Signed-off-by: Hans Dedecker ---
